Blue paper covers with printed title edges chipped. Clean text throughout. "Referenced by: Ford Select List 1833-1899 p.29 "Henry Cronin Pratt was a highly regarded citizen. He was actuary of the Sudbury Savings Bank. He was also manager and traveller for wine merchant Mrs Adams. He was a prominent freemason of the Sudbury Suffolk Lodge Secretary of the Gas Company distributor of Stamps and manager of a printing Business. He was also a leading conservative figure. He began the simplest of frauds at the bank. A depositor would come into the bank to withdraw funds say �50 and Henry would write in the depositors pass book that they had withdrawn �50 but in the corresponding bank ledger he would write say �80 and pocket the difference. On the 24th October 1893 a Mr. Jackson came to inspect the bank records so he fled. It transpired the Henry Cronin over the years had stolen �17000 around �1000000 today. Which amounted to over half of the bank�s assets. The town was shocked and angry and frightened for the loss of their savings and the story made headline news. However fortunately for the people of Sudbury the town�s savings bank was somewhat different. The unsuspecting trustees of the bank all very honourable and worldly men had no idea they were liable. Of the 7 trustees 4 were members of the Sudbury Suffolk Masonic Lodge and 3 were Vicars. They were liable for paying back the shortfall. - See: The Rector and the Rogue: A Victorian Melodrama. A sheet of pale grey paper with 28 panels storyboarding the advertisement for the Bowery Savings Bank Ogilvy & Mather Commercial No. ZBAC 8789. Joe DiMaggio appears in twelve close-ups and several other distant shots. Each image is captioned with the slugger's narrated text. "This city wasn't built by frightened people. And frightened people won't save it. Cities do dies. Today we have a choice. We can choose whether New York lives or dies. Chose life. Like the tides around it New York rises and falls. Looks like the tide's up. We're gonna be all right." A telling memorial to the troubles in 1970s New York. Ogilvy & Mather Inc unknown

Two documents from an American immigrant social and recreational club that formed part of the diverse cultural mosaic of 19th century San Francisco. The documents are directed to The Hibernia Savings and Loan Society and are signed by the President the Secretary and three different trustees. Both are stamped with the club's rubber stamp seal. Two paper documents with the later 1897 document tipped-in on top updating the signing officers from the club's original 1895 printed resolution. The Jan. 10th 1895 printed resolution measures 15 inches tall x 9.25 inches wide and is printed recto onto laid paper watermarked "PENELOPE LINEN" and contains black ink infill. The Jan. 20th 1897 update document measures 9.75 inches tall x 7.75 inches wide and is executed recto in black ink onto lined writing paper. Both documents with some creases mailing fold lines and toning the 1895 resolution also has scattered stains and tiny losses along top edge. The San Francisco History Center branch of The San Francisco Public Library holds ephemera from the Swiss Rifle Club in their San Francisco Ephemera Collection Call Number: SF SUB COLL however their documents carry a date of 1910 - fifteen years later than these 19th c. documents. Bancroft Library at UC Berkeley holds The Hibernia Savings and Loan Society ledgers 1859-1906 with the names of many famous subscribers and well-known founders. "Hibernia Savings and Loan Society was incorporated April 12 1859 in San Francisco California by a group of Irish businessmen in order to provide the Irish community with a secure place of deposit for their savings." "In the first and longest essay Hayek develops his well-known theory of industrial fluctuations beyond the point at which it was left in his Prices and Production. While the central argument of this theory remains the same, it is now restated on somewhat different and more realistic assumptions and in less abstract forms and certain important improvements are introduced. The main advance concerns the relationship between the rate of interest and the rate of profit. The other essays deal with particular problems in the same field such as demand for capital, capital maintenance, the factors governing investment, and the supply of savings. The first essay appears for the first time; the others are collected, and in part translated from various English and foreign journals in which they were originally published." - from dust jacket. 500366598Basil Blackwell Sans date. Cet ouvrage de Ragnar Nurkse publié en 1953 examine les obstacles à la formation de capital dans les pays sous-développés. Il introduit le concept de 'cercle vicieux de la pauvreté' où les faibles revenus entraînent une épargne et un investissement insuffisants perpétuant ainsi la stagnation économique. Le livre est issu de six conférences données à Rio de Janeiro en 1951
